Sinatra's years on the Capitol label (1953-60) were great years. His voice had matured into a powerful and poignant instrument; his sense of swing was infallible; and he was blessed with an innovative and sophisticated arranger, Nelson Riddle, whose charts fit Sinatra like a beautiful suit.

$12.89 This is a particularly interesting program by boppish guitarist Mark Elf. The date starts out strong (with "Trickynometry" and "Dot Com Blues"), featuring a quintet that includes trumpeter Nicholas Payton, and one regrets that Payton is only on one of the remaining ten numbers. In addition to Elf (who is in top form), the musicians include Bobby LaVell on tenor (for the same three songs as Payton), either Christian McBride or Neal Miner on bass and drummer Yoron Israel. Grady Tate and Miles Griffith take a vocal apiece, but most tunes feature Elf in a trio. The music is consistently excellent with other highlights including "Just In Time," "Milestones" and "Monk Like"; if only Payton (who sounds pretty fiery in spots) had been persuaded to stick around for the other songs too. ~ Scott Yanow
